To back up Yahoo emails to a hard drive on Windows, use one of the methods below. Manual methods are suitable for a few messages, while Outlook or backup software is better for folders or regular backups.
Step 1. Please open Yahoo Mail by typing your Email address and Password.
Step 2. Navigate to the Mail in the top right corner and click on it.
Step 3. Open the email you want to save and copy its content by pressing Ctrl+C on your keyboard.
Step 4. Now, open the MS Word File and Paste your email by pressing the Ctrl+V keys simultaneously.
Step 5. After that, select the Save As option under the File tab.
Step 6. In the end, choose the Destination path for the word file and hit the Save button.
Step 1. Access Yahoo Mail and log in using your credentials.
Step 2. Select the Mail you want to save or backup and click on the More icon.
Step 3. Choose the Print option to save the email as PDF.
Step 4. Now, on the Print window, choose Save as PDF on the Destination column. Click on Save.
Step 5. Then, you will be asked to name the print file and save it to your target hard drive.
Stage 1: First, add Yahoo Mail to the Outlook desktop application.
Step 1. Launch the MS Outlook application on your PC by entering your credentials.
Step 2. Locate and click on the Add Account button.
Step 3. Enter your Yahoo email account and click on Connect. Then, enter your Yahoo Mail password, and tap Connect again.
✍Note:
If you have trouble connecting your Yahoo account with Outlook, you may need to use a Yahoo app password instead of your regular account password.
Step 4. Open the Outlook desktop client, and you should see Yahoo Mail in Outlook configured successfully.
Stage 2: Now you can start to export Yahoo emails from Outlook to hard drive.
Step 1. To initiate the process, navigate to File > Open & Export > Import & Export.
Step 2. Then choose Export to a file and click on Next.
Step 3. Select the specific Yahoo folders you wish to export from, and make sure to tick the "Include subfolders" checkbox. Then, click "Next".
Step 4. Use the default location or browse for a location where you want to save the exported file, and click Finish.
